Waitress
A young woman works as a waitress at a diner in a small Southern USA town. Her passion is baking pies, and she comes up with winning ideas. Her home life is not so great, as her husband does not treat her well. She wants to enter a big pie-baking competition, but he doesn't like the idea. Then she finds out she's pregnant, which is the last thing she needs. This leads her to a charming doctor, and before you know it, these two married people are deep into extra-marital affair territory. Perhaps there is still a way for her to escape from everything and find her true destiny? The film was a favourite at Sundance.
